Key Specifications of the Huawei Nova Y72S
The Huawei Nova Y72S (8GB/128GB) packs robust hardware tailored for Kenyan users who prioritize performance and durability. Below are its standout specifications:
- Display: 6.75-inch IPS LCD with 1600×720 HD+ resolution and 90Hz refresh rate for smooth scrolling
- Build: Premium plastic frame with a glossy glass-like back panel (anti-fingerprint coating)
- Performance: Octa-core MediaTek Helio G85 processor (12nm) optimized for gaming and multitasking
- Storage: 128GB internal storage (expandable via microSD up to 512GB) + 8GB RAM with Huawei’s memory optimization
- Battery: 6000mAh capacity with 22.5W fast charging (3-day standby time for light users)
- Camera: Triple rear setup (50MP main + 2MP depth + 2MP macro) and 8MP front camera with AI portrait modes
- OS: EMUI 12 based on HarmonyOS 2.0 (no Google Play Services but supports Huawei AppGallery and Petal Search)
- Certifications: IPX4 splash resistance and TÜV Rheinland low blue light certification for eye protection
Designed for Kenya’s power outages and dust-prone environments, it includes a superior heat dissipation system and dual SIM + dedicated microSD slot.

Essential Buying Tips for Huawei Nova Y72S in Kenya
To ensure you get genuine value when purchasing the Huawei Nova Y72S, follow these expert recommendations:
- Physical Inspection: Check for Huawei holographic seals on the box, verify IMEI (dial *#06#) matches packaging, and inspect charging port for wear if buying used.
- Seller Verification: Always ask “Is this an official Huawei Kenya warranty?” and request demonstration of Petal Search functionality to confirm software authenticity.
- Warranty Details: Ensure warranty card has dealer stamp and covers both parts (1 year) and labor (additional 6 months) – crucial for battery replacements.
- Red Flags: Avoid sellers offering prices below Ksh 23,000, devices with pre-installed APK files, or those refusing to provide purchase receipts.
- Post-Purchase: Register device immediately on Huawei’s Kenya portal for warranty activation and access to service centers in 14 major towns.
Pro Tip: Test the 90Hz display by swiping through settings – noticeable lag indicates possible refurbished unit.

Frequently Asked Questions About Huawei Nova Y72S in Kenya
Does the Huawei Nova Y72S support Google apps?
The Nova Y72S runs HarmonyOS which doesn’t support Google Mobile Services. However, you can access most apps through Huawei AppGallery or use Petal Search to find web-based alternatives. Popular apps like WhatsApp and Facebook have HarmonyOS-compatible versions available.
How long does the 6000mAh battery last with normal use?
With moderate usage (5 hours screen time daily), the battery lasts 2-3 days. Heavy users (gaming/video streaming) get 12-15 hours continuous use. The 22.5W fast charging fully replenishes the battery in about 2 hours 15 minutes.
